    Outdoor spaces can be cozy in winter with the use of patio heaters that emit radiant infrared light. Unlike indoor space heaters that blast air across hot coils to warm the air, these units emit infrared energy into solid objects like people and furnishings. The energy is absorbed by the object and turned into heat, allowing you stay warm when the temperatures decrease.

    The main concern should be to keep the heaters clear from any combustible objects, and not use them when winds are more than 10 miles an hour. This is particularly important when using a free-standing or tabletop model, as the wind could easily knock them over. Utilizing a ceiling- or wall-mounted model eliminates this problem, but you should still keep the heaters at a safe distance from any flammable materials and ensure they don't block walkways, doors or other elements of your outdoor space.

    Do not use extension cords when using an electric patio heater. Even if you plug into one heater an extension cord could cause an overload on the circuit, which could result in overheating and even fire. Instead, choose a hardwired electrical heater that is directly connected to an outlet.

    It's a good idea to keep an extinguisher in close proximity to both top rated electric patio heaters and propane models. Infrared heating is extremely safe, but accidents can occur, so it's crucial to be prepared.

    It's important to keep heaters away from children and pets, because they can get close and suffer burns. Also, they should be kept away from furniture so that they don't damage the upholstery. Don't leave a heater running unattended.

    Whether you choose a propane or electric patio heater, always read the instructions of the manufacturer carefully prior to operating it. This will help to ensure that the patio heater is installed and operated correctly, minimizing the chance of an accident.
